Firefighters responded to a house fire in the 100 block of N. Hinman Ave. shortly after 2:30 a.m. Monday.

No one was home at the time, and no injuries were reported.

Because of the size of the fire, crews attacked it from outside the home using specialized equipment capable of delivering large amounts of water. The fire was extinguished in just over an hour, but the home was a total loss.

The Fire Marshal's Office is investigating the cause of the fire. https://alrt.se/u/6ADDs6sg9oZ

Good Tuesday morning, neighbors -

U.S. and State of Michigan flags are to be lowered to half-staff today, Tuesday, Aug. 18, by order of Michigan Governor Gretchen Whitmer , to honor the life and service of Detroit Firefighter Patrick Trout, who passed away in the line of duty. πŸ‡ΊπŸ‡Έ

Trout served in the Detroit Fire Department for 12 years, protecting the citizens of Detroit. Beyond his service to Detroit, he also was a retired U.S. Army Sergeant who also served in the National Guard and Army Reserves.

β€œPatrick Trout was a proud family man and dedicated public servant. He was an example of the selflessness and dedication firefighters across Michigan demonstrate each and every day. Let’s honor this fallen hero and keep his family and the entire Detroit Fire Department in our thoughts.”
-Gov. Whitmer

To lower flags to half-staff, flags should be hoisted first to the peak for an instant and then lowered to the half-staff position. The process is reversed before the flag is lowered for the day.

Flags should be returned to full staff Wednesday, Aug. 19.
